Little Fish doesn't like being the smalles fish in school. He can nevery keep up and he always gets left behind. Then, on a trip to the coral reef, Little Fish discovers that being small has it's advantages. Find out wat happens when Little Fish becomes a big hero in this fanastic underwater adventure.

About Matthew Scott

Matthew Scott is a freelance illustrator who has produced award-winning illustrations for children's books, interactive apps, magazines, board games, cartoons, greetings cards and much more. He is based in the UK.
